The Early stages of Audiology

Audiology's roots can be traced back to ancient times when civilizations like the Egyptians and Greeks first began to recognize and record hearing impairments. Nevertheless, it wasn't till the 19th century that the study of hearing took on a more scientific method. The development of the ear trumpet in the late 18th century, a rudimentary device developed to enhance noise for the hard of hearing, marked among the earliest efforts to address hearing loss.

The Birth of Modernized Audiology

The turning point for audiology came after World War II, as thousands of veterans returned home with noise-induced hearing loss triggered by direct exposure to loud surges and equipment. This developed an immediate need for effective treatments and rehabilitation services, catalyzing the establishment of audiology as a formal profession. Audiologists started with fundamental diagnostic tests to examine hearing loss and rapidly moved towards establishing more sophisticated audiometric techniques.

Technological Advancements and Key Discoveries

One of the most significant advancements in audiology included the development of the electronic hearing aid in the 20th century. Early models were large and restricted in performance, however the advent of digital technology in the latter half of the century transformed hearing aid design, making devices smaller, more powerful, and efficient in offering a clearer sound quality.

The 1970s saw a substantial improvement with the advancement of cochlear implants, which are advanced electronic gadgets that can promote the acoustic nerve to help individuals with severe deafness who do not benefit from regular hearing aids. For many years, audiological research study has actually widened to check out not just the physical aspects of hearing loss but also the psychological and social impacts, acknowledging how hearing troubles can impact interaction, believing, and general well-being. This expanded perspective on hearing health has promoted a more inclusive treatment technique that combines technical interventions with counseling and auditory rehabilitation.

The Digital Period and More

Presently, audiology is at the leading edge of the digital age, with development in artificial intelligence (AI), telehealth, and personalized medicine affecting the instructions of hearing health care. Contemporary hearing devices such as hearing aids and cochlear implants utilize AI innovation to get used to various surroundings, offering a high degree of clarity and customization. The schedule of tele-audiology services, enabled by internet connections, has increased the availability of hearing care by making it possible for remote assessments, fittings, and discussions.
